Создание предварительно скомпилированных файлов для приложения asp.net mvc с помощью сборки Jenkins - PullRequest
0 голосов
/ 31 октября 2018

Я не могу сгенерировать предварительно скомпилированные файлы (.compiled файлы) для приложения asp.net mvc со сборкой Jenkin. Но мы можем генерировать предварительно скомпилированные файлы при локальном запуске с помощью приведенной ниже команды и опции публикации слияния. но не генерируется с помощью Jenkin build. Ошибка говорит: «Недействительное свойство».

msbuild command : MSBuild.exe "C:\GitHub\website1\Test.UI\test.UI.csproj" /p:Configuration=Release /t:Clean;Rebuild;MvcPreCompileViews;_CopyWebApplication /p:OutDir=.\Deploy /p:Configuration=Release /p:Platform=AnyCPU /verbosity:d

Я попытался добавить p:AspnetCompileMerge=true с этой командой, но все еще не надеюсь.

имеет следующие настройки в файле UI.csprj.

<MvcBuildViews>false</MvcBuildViews>

<Target Name="MvcBuildViews" AfterTargets="AfterBuild" Condition="'$(MvcBuildViews)'=='true'">
  <AspNetCompiler VirtualPath="temp" PhysicalPath="$(WebProjectOutputDir)" />
</Target>

Может кто-нибудь помочь?

...